203 ('Digital signatures', """
204 Each software author creates a 'key-pair'; a 'public key' and a 'private key'. Without going \
205 into the maths, only something encrypted with the private key will decrypt with the public key.
207 So, when a programmer releases some software, they encrypt it with their private key (which no-one \
208 else has). When you download it, the injector checks that it decrypts using their public key, thus \
209 proving that it came from them and hasn't been tampered with."""),
212 After the injector has checked that the software hasn't been modified since it was signed with \
213 the private key, you still have the following problems:
215 1. Does the public key you have really belong to the author?
216 2. Even if the software really did come from that person, do you trust them?"""),
